At the Delivery of the King's Gaol of Newgate holden for the County of Middlesex at
Justices Hall in the Old Bailey in the Suburbs of the City of London on Wednesday the
fifteenth day of September in the Second Year of the Reign of our Sovereign Lord
George the third now King of Great Britain Etc and in the Year of our Lord 1792

James Collins< no role >
James Wham< no role > }
Attainted of Felony and Robbery are severally
Ordered to be hanged by the neck until they are
Dead

Arthur Clarke< no role >
Convicted of feloniously receiving Goods knowing
them to have been Stolen agt. the Statute Etc Is
Ordered to be Transported for the Term of fourteen
Years to same of his Majesty's Colonies or
Plantations in America

Robert Everett< no role >
Convicted of Grand Larceny Is Ordered to be branded
in the hand and discharged

Sarah Mott< no role >
Convicted of Petty Larceny is Ordered to be openly
and Publickly Whipt until her Body is bloody
and Discharged
